a change in the nucleotide sequence of a gene can lead to a change in _______, which can lead to a change in in the amino acid s
skad [1K]

Answer:the messenger rna

Explanation:

A change in the DNA sequence of a gene leads to a change in the nucleotide sequence in the messenger RNA, which can lead to a change in the amino acid sequence of the resulting protein.

List and briefly describe in your own words the four main points of Darwins theory.
patriot [66]

Answer:

Individuals of a species are not identical, Traits are passed from generation to generation, more offspring are born that can survive,and only the surviovrs of the competition for resources will reproduce.
